Review of Wastewater Solution
Wastewater systems are vital framework elements that play a crucial duty in managing previously owned water from household, industrial, and agricultural sources. These systems are developed to gather, treat, discharge, and transport wastewater, making sure that it is refined effectively before coming back the environment. The main parts of a wastewater system consist of collection networks, therapy centers, and discharge mechanisms.
Collection networks commonly contain a collection of pipes and pumping terminals that gather wastewater from different sources and guide it to therapy facilities. Treatment centers are equipped with advanced technologies that remove microorganisms and pollutants, transforming polluted water right into a cleaner state ideal for release or reuse. This procedure frequently includes numerous phases, including initial, key, additional, and often tertiary therapy, each made to deal with details contaminants.
The last of a wastewater system entails the secure discharge or recycling of cured water, which can be gone back to natural water bodies or repurposed for irrigation and industrial procedures. By successfully taking care of wastewater, these systems not only secure public health and wellness and the environment however additionally contribute to the lasting use of water sources, making them essential in modern framework.
Environmental Impacts of Poor Management
The repercussions of poor wastewater administration can be profound, leading to significant environmental destruction. Badly taken care of wastewater systems frequently lead to the contamination of neighborhood water bodies, presenting hazardous toxins such as heavy steels, virus, and nutrients. This contamination can interfere with water communities, leading to decreased biodiversity and the decrease of delicate varieties.
Furthermore, neglected or improperly dealt with wastewater can contribute to eutrophication, a procedure where excess nutrients stimulate algal flowers. These flowers deplete oxygen degrees in the water, creating dead areas that are inhospitable to most aquatic life. Furthermore, the presence of microorganisms in neglected wastewater postures significant public wellness dangers, potentially leading to waterborne conditions that affect both animal and human populaces.
Dirt contamination is one more essential worry, as leachate from incorrectly handled wastewater can infiltrate groundwater supplies, jeopardizing drinking water quality. The advancing impacts of these ecological influences extend beyond instant ecological repercussions, adding to long-lasting challenges such as environment modification and source scarcity. Understanding and dealing with the implications of bad wastewater management is essential for advertising environmental sustainability and making certain the health of environments and neighborhoods alike.

Innovative Technologies in Wastewater Therapy
Innovations in ingenious modern technologies are reinventing wastewater treatment processes, straightening with the objectives of sustainability and efficiency. These innovations include a variety of methods designed to enhance the treatment procedure while decreasing ecological influence. One notable improvement is the implementation of membrane bioreactors (MBRs), which integrate biological treatment with membrane purification, leading to high-grade effluent and lowered power usage.

Additionally, the introduction of decentralized treatment systems supplies versatile remedies for communities, lowering the requirement for comprehensive framework and advertising resource recuperation through nutrient recycling. These technologies not just improve therapy efficiency however also contribute to a round economic situation by recouping important sources from wastewater. As the market remains to evolve, accepting these ingenious innovations will play a critical role in accomplishing environmental sustainability and guaranteeing a reputable wastewater management system for future generations.
